Ceasefire Pakistan efforts will continue as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ishaq Dar called on all parties to maintain the ceasefire and emphasized Pakistan’s ongoing diplomatic role in facilitating dialogue between Iran and the United States.
🇵🇰 Pakistan Urges Ceasefire Continuity
Ishaq Dar stated that it is essential for all sides to remain committed to the ceasefire. He stressed that maintaining stability is critical for ensuring long-term peace in the region.
He highlighted that Pakistan will continue to encourage both sides to uphold their commitments and avoid escalation.
🤝 Pakistan’s Role in Mediation
During a media briefing in Islamabad, Ishaq Dar confirmed that Pakistan played a mediating role in the negotiations between Iran and the United States.
He noted that both he and Field Marshal Syed Asim Munir were involved in facilitating discussions that spanned multiple stages and required sustained diplomatic engagement.
⏱️ Talks Conclude After Extended Discussions
According to officials, the negotiations continued for approximately 24 hours before reaching their conclusion.
The talks were described as constructive despite being challenging, reflecting the complexity of the issues involved.
🌍 Appreciation for Pakistan’s Efforts
Ishaq Dar expressed gratitude to both Iran and the United States for acknowledging Pakistan’s role in the mediation process.
He stated that recognition from both sides reflects confidence in Pakistan’s diplomatic efforts and commitment to peace.

🔄 Continued Diplomatic Engagement Planned
Pakistan plans to remain actively engaged in promoting dialogue between Iran and the United States.
Ishaq Dar reiterated that the country will continue its diplomatic efforts in the coming days to support communication and cooperation between the two sides.
📊 Positive Response to Ceasefire Appeal
The Foreign Minister also acknowledged that both countries responded positively to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if’s call for an immediate ceasefire.
He added that the acceptance of Pakistan’s invitation to hold talks in Islamabad marked a significant step toward de-escalation.
